In a analyze of Rorden [29] 4 radiologists, blinded on the ear phenotype, assessed radiographs of twenty-two Scottish Fold/Straight cats. All cats had been genotyped showing the heterozygous mutation in all folded ear cats but not in straight cats. Every single reviewer gave on common the folded ear cats a worse "severity rating", having said that the photographs showed much milder indicators than previously released.

The breeding plan of Ross and Turner resulted in seventy six kittens in the very first a few years. Of those, forty two have been born with folded ears and The remainder had straight ears. Using this, the conclusion was drawn that the folded ears resulted from an easy dominant gene.

For the reason that initial worries were brought, the Fold breed hasn't had the mite and infection problems, however wax buildup in the ears can be better than in other cats.[one] The concerns about deformities may possibly have been attributable to osteochondrodysplasia, which results in abnormalities in bone and cartilage through the entire overall body. The pinnacle is spherical and also the folded ears heighten that illusion of roundness. The eyes are very round, dazzling and distinct. The legs seem round, as does the tail compared to its size.
This Scottish cat is pure glistening white. They've got pink noses and paws, with eyes of blue, copper, or gold. Many of them have eyes of various colors, which is frequently a person blue eye and one copper or gold eye.

"Like all other cats, they call for satisfactory mental and environmental enrichment," Gerken says. "So ensuring they may have scratching posts, vertical and horizontal Areas like perches and hiding spots, many different toys that needs to be rotated on a weekly foundation to offer novelty, and structured social and Engage in sessions with the spouse and children is important for their effectively-becoming."

Osteochondrodysplasia is a disease that is unique to Scottish Folds. It was discovered that if a folded ear Scottish fold was bred to another folded ear, many of the offspring developed a severe crippling lameness early in life. Cats affected had shortened, malformed legs and tail as well as abnormalities affecting the growth plates and spine. Scottish folds should be bred ONLY folded ear to straight ear and are not to be bred by people who are not dedicated to the health and well-being of these animals. We genetically test all our breeding cats for the fold gene and never, ever breed fold to fold.
